Sakupwanya tournament returns

Ray Bande
Senior Reporter
PREPARATIONS for the annual Sakupwanya Tournament are at an advanced stage with participants in football and netball expected to battle for supremacy at its usual venue – St Mathias Tsonzo grounds – on July 4.
Started by the late water resources strategist Dr Jeftar Sakupwanya in 1997 with only three schools – St Matthias Tsonzo High, Pafiwa Mutasa High and Vumbunu Secondary, the tournament now encompasses the whole of Mutasa district schools.
19 schools are expected to participate in football, volleyball and netball.
Dr Sakupwanya died on December 17, 2023.
